Hao Chun, Director of the China Manned Space Agency, said that during the construction of China's space station, 2022 more missions will be carried out in 6. At the press conference held by the State Council Press Office today, Hao Chun gave information about the space missions that China will undertake this year.
“The Tianzhou-4 cargo spacecraft will be launched in May,” Hao said. In June, the three astronauts will be sent to the core module of the space station by the Shenzhou-14 spacecraft and will work there for 6 months. In July, the experimental module named Wentian, and in December, the experimental module named Mengtian will dock with the core module of the space station. Thus, the 'T' shaped space station consisting of three modules will be established. After that, the Tianzhou-5 cargo spacecraft will be launched. In addition, three new astronauts will be sent to the space station with the Shenzhou-15 spacecraft to replace the three astronauts assigned to the space station.” used the phrases.
